Casablanca

Casablanca is so much more than a classic Bogart movie with killer one-liners. It is also the largest, most cosmopolitan city in the country of Morocco. Sitting at the economic and industrial heart of this region, Casablanca has a population of approximately four million. Brush up on your high school French before visiting this lively city as it's the main language spoken by the locals. While this is the most liberal and progressive city in Morocco, remember to be cautious in this region of the world with your western views.

Vigo

Originally a small fishing town, Vigo has grown to become the most populated municipality in the region of Galicia in northwestern Spain. Remnants of the old world still exist in its historic center architecture and plazas, while the commodities of a modern city have blended into its boundaries. The old center remains the hub of activity with plenty to see and do, shopping and dining included.

Which place is cheaper, Vigo or Casablanca?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.

The average daily cost (per person) in Casablanca is $95, while the average daily cost in Vigo is $147.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Casablanca and Vigo in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Casablanca or Vigo?

Vigo has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Casablanca exper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.

Should I visit Casablanca or Vigo in the Summer?

Both Vigo and Casablanca are popular destinations to visit in the summer with plenty of activities. The warm climate attracts visitors to Casablanca throughout the year.

Casablanca is around the same temperature as Vigo in the summer. The daily temperature in Casablanca averages around 23°C (73°F) in July, and Vigo fluctuates around 21°C (70°F).

It's quite sunny in Vigo. The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Casablanca. Casablanca usually receives around the same amount of sunshine as Vigo during summer. Casablanca gets 303 hours of sunny skies, while Vigo receives 299 hours of full sun in the summer.

In July, Casablanca usually receives less rain than Vigo. Casablanca gets 1 mm (0 in) of rain, while Vigo receives 37 mm (1.5 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Should I visit Casablanca or Vigo in the Autumn?

Both Vigo and Casablanca during the autumn are popular places to visit. Plenty of visitors come to Casablanca because of the warm climate and sunshine that lasts throughout the year.

In the autumn, Casablanca is a little warmer than Vigo. Typically, the autumn temperatures in Casablanca in October average around 20°C (67°F), and Vigo averages at about 17°C (62°F).

It's quite sunny in Casablanca. In the autumn, Casablanca often gets more sunshine than Vigo. Casablanca gets 233 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Vigo receives 174 hours of full sun.

Vigo gets a good bit of rain this time of year. Casablanca usually gets less rain in October than Vigo. Casablanca gets 31 mm (1.2 in) of rain, while Vigo receives 164 mm (6.5 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Casablanca or Vigo in the Winter?

The winter attracts plenty of travelers to both Casablanca and Vigo. Warm weather and sunshine bring visitors to Casablanca year-round.

In January, Casablanca is generally a little warmer than Vigo. Daily temperatures in Casablanca average around 13°C (55°F), and Vigo fluctuates around 10°C (50°F).

Casablanca usually receives more sunshine than Vigo during winter. Casablanca gets 190 hours of sunny skies, while Vigo receives 110 hours of full sun in the winter.

Vigo receives a lot of rain in the winter. In January, Casablanca usually receives less rain than Vigo. Casablanca gets 62 mm (2.5 in) of rain, while Vigo receives 232 mm (9.1 in) of rain each month for the winter.

Should I visit Casablanca or Vigo in the Spring?

The spring brings many poeple to Casablanca as well as Vigo. Casablanca attracts visitors year-round for its warm weather and sunny climate.

Casablanca is a little warmer than Vigo in the spring. The daily temperature in Casablanca averages around 16°C (60°F) in April, and Vigo fluctuates around 13°C (56°F).

People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Casablanca this time of the year. In the spring, Casablanca often gets more sunshine than Vigo. Casablanca gets 262 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Vigo receives 198 hours of full sun.

It's quite rainy in Vigo. Casablanca usually gets less rain in April than Vigo. Casablanca gets 40 mm (1.6 in) of rain, while Vigo receives 125 mm (4.9 in) of rain this time of the year.

Typical Weather for Vigo and Casablanca

Casablanca Vigo
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 13°C (55°F) 62 mm (2.5 in) 10°C (50°F) 232 mm (9.1 in)
Feb 14°C (57°F) 60 mm (2.4 in) 11°C (52°F) 230 mm (9.1 in)
Mar 15°C (58°F) 51 mm (2 in) 12°C (54°F) 160 mm (6.3 in)
Apr 16°C (60°F) 40 mm (1.6 in) 13°C (56°F) 125 mm (4.9 in)
May 18°C (64°F) 19 mm (0.7 in) 16°C (60°F) 137 mm (5.4 in)
Jun 21°C (69°F) 6 mm (0.2 in) 19°C (66°F) 69 mm (2.7 in)
Jul 23°C (73°F) 1 mm (0 in) 21°C (70°F) 37 mm (1.5 in)
Aug 23°C (74°F) 0 mm (0 in) 21°C (69°F) 34 mm (1.3 in)
Sep 22°C (72°F) 5 mm (0.2 in) 20°C (68°F) 118 mm (4.6 in)
Oct 20°C (67°F) 31 mm (1.2 in) 17°C (62°F) 164 mm (6.5 in)
Nov 16°C (62°F) 72 mm (2.9 in) 13°C (55°F) 186 mm (7.3 in)
Dec 14°C (57°F) 80 mm (3.1 in) 11°C (51°F) 228 mm (9 in)
